About The Artist
Vernon Rollins, 1951-2012. He was an American artist from Tidewater, Virginia. He's known for his paintings of the
Atlantic seashore and tideland scenery. Coastal lighthouses and rolling sand dunes are constant sources of
inspiration and subject matter. His paintings are predominantly realistic, although his admiration of the French
impressionists is frequently reflected in his works of water lilies, poppy fields, and native wild flowers. He worked
with acrylic polymer.
Rollins earned a BA degree from Baylor University in Theatrical Scenery Design and Production. Memberships: The
American Art Society and the Rehoboth Art League of Rehoboth Beach Delaware. His works are in both private and
public collections including The Museum of the Albemarle, The American Art Society, the Seaside Art Gallery in Nags
Head, North Carolina, and The Mu Epsilon Society of Realistic Painters.
